The symbol shows the location of the Winter Hill (Bolton, England) transmitter which serves 2,690,000 homes. The bright green areas shown where the signal from this transmitter is strong, dark green areas are poorer signals. Those parts shown in yellow may have interference on the same frequency from other masts.

Format
crid://authority/data
The "authority" part is "default_authority" and is usually present as a string in an SDT descriptor
The "data" part on freeview and Freesat appears as strings in descriptors at the event level in the EIT and always starts with a slash - or should do!
That makes no sense to me, given the format definition contains a slash, but that's the way it is.

As this hasn't been posted for a while, there were many changes to UHF frequencies across the country during the 700MHz Clearance program. The site owner here struggled to keep up with all the changes - there are over 1100 transmitters in the UK. Whilst a number didn't change, most changes were notified in PDF documents most of which had to be read manually.
Here on the Winter Hill page, two of the Local multiplex details haven't been updated.
For the sake of clarity, here is the current data -
In the multiplex order BBCA/PSB1, D3&4/PSB2, BBCB HD/PSB3, SDN/COM4, ArqA/COM5, ArqB/COM6
Winter Hill UHF channels are -
The main multiplexes are C32, C34, C35, C29, C31, C37
The Local ones are Local Manchester, Manchester GI on C24 & C27.
Liverpool Local mux on C21, Preston Local mux on C40.
If you hover over the C channel numbers, it should give you the frequency.
What you can receive and how well will depend on location, a full postcode is needed to look at predictions.
